Find the slope, x and y intercepts and sketch the graph for the linear equation. y = 2x + 1

Answer:

In bold below.

Step-by-step explanation:

The slope = coefficient of x = 2.

The y-intercept is when x = 0 and x-intercept is when y = 0.

y = 2(0) + 1 = 1  so the y -intercept is (0, 1).

2x + 1 = 0

x = -0.5 so the x-intercept is (-0.5, 0)

Write the equation in the form Ax + By = C. Find an equation of a line passing through the pair of points (-7,3) and (-8,-9).
Illusion [34]

Answer:

  12x -y = -87

Step-by-step explanation:

You can start with the 2-point form of the equation of a line and manipulate it to give you the standard form.

  y = (y2 -y1)/(x2 -x1)(x -x1) +y1

  y = (-9 -3)/(-8 -(-7))(x -(-7)) +3

  y = (-12/-1)(x +7) +3

  y = 12x +84 +3

  -12x +y = 87 . . . . . subtract the x-term

  12x -y = -87 . . . . . . make the leading coefficient positive (per standard form)
